Based on mycarcheck.com data, this model has been looked up 21 times, with 12 different VINs recorded, indicating steady interest among buyers and sellers. Its average private sale valuation is around 500 pounds, with a typical mileage of about 93,000 miles and approximately five to six previous owners.
